- The distance between Appleby, New Zealand and Chatham, Nb, Canada is approximately 15,408 km or 9,575 mi.
- To reach Appleby in this distance one would set out from Chatham, Nb bearing 255.7°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Appleby bearing 241.6° or WSW .
- Appleby has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Chatham, Nb has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Appleby is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Chatham, Nb is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 8.1 °C (14.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 19.2 °C (34.6°F) less in Appleby.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 101.1 mm (4 in) less which is equivalent to 101.1 l/m² (2.48 US gal/ft²) or 1,011,000 l/ha (108,083 US gal/ac) less.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.1° higher in Appleby than in Chatham, Nb.
